The effects of oxidation upon strength degradation of C/C composites

摘要

Carbon/Carbon (C/C) composites have superior high temperature strength in an inert atmosphere. However, carbon materials have a defective property that they can actively react with oxygen in an oxidation environment at above 500 deg C. In this study, mechanical properties of oxidized C/C composite were investigated by 3 points bending tests. As a result, reductions of bending and shear strength were preferentially recognized in case of the specimen oxidized at 600 deg C comparing to that oxidized at 1000 deg C, even when the total weight loss is almost the same. And, examinations of shear mode fracture behavior by CCD camera indicate that continuous delamination of fiber/matrix interface have been progressed.
